Welcome to on-call for the Glimmerpane design system! Our snapshot tests live in the `snapcheck` suite and run on every merge to main. If a UI component changes visually, the diff bot flags it — usually it's an intentional tweak, so just approve the new baseline. If it's 2am and snapshots are failing across the board, it's almost always a font-loading race, not your problem. To unlock the baseline store and re-approve snapshots in bulk, use the recovery passphrase below.

recovery phrase for tahag-taguf: wenix-caswyn

## Break-Glass: Graphlume Dependency Visualizer

If Graphlume's render service hangs and blocks the release gate at Ostrand Labs, use break-glass to bypass the graph check. Flag it in the weekly sync notes. Bypass auto-expires after 24 hours. Abuse gets the escalation path removed. Opening the break-glass credential locker requires the recovery passphrase below.

strongbox words: ralvan-silael-rusvan-gorvan-novvan-eliion-aldath-gormir-ulador

# Break-Glass Access: Tenant Rate Quotas

When the Quotarium service misbehaves and a tenant is being throttled incorrectly, normal changes go through the quota review queue. In emergencies, break-glass access lets on-call override per-tenant limits directly in the control plane. Use it sparingly; every override is audited and auto-reverts after four hours. To unlock the override console you will need the recovery passphrase, recorded immediately below this paragraph.

vault phrase of hahop-badug = novvan-ulaion-zorius-noviel-gorwyn-casix-tamys